Tigers to Play Two Today on WHTC; Cubs Win, Sox & Caps Lose on Tuesday
Briefly

Inclement weather led to the postponement of the Detroit Tigers' game against the Nationals, resulting in a day/night doubleheader scheduled for today. Matthew Boyd pitched seven innings with five strikeouts to elevate the Cubs to a 5-2 victory over the Cleveland Guardians. The Dodgers dominated the Chicago White Sox with a decisive 6-1 win, highlighted by Michael Conforto's two-run single in the first inning. In minor league action, the Great Lakes Loons outscored the West Michigan Whitecaps 14-9, buoyed by Zyhir Hope's two-run double during a nine-run sixth inning.
